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
129 87638424912 6642740653
1180091 354928 387689981
1180091 354928 387689981
5969 57922 492101042 79
All about undefined
Interested in learning more?
1180091 354928 387689981
5969 57922 492101042 79
See more
30845143687 6537 413969
295199 45916358 6364333026
See more
118477516 9641765 087
008 018371475 2358 94
See more